Enhanced Small Extracellular Vesicle Uptake by Activated Interneurons Improves Stroke Recovery in Mice.

Abstract

Neuronal circuitry remodelling, which comprises excitatory and inhibitory neurons, is critical for improving neurological outcomes after a stroke. Preclinical studies have shown that small extracellular vesicles (sEVs) have a therapeutic effect on stroke recovery. However, it is highly challenging to use sEVs to specifically target individual neuronal populations to enhance neuronal circuitry remodelling after stroke. In the present study, using a chemogenetic approach to specifically activate peri-infarct cortical interneurons in combination with the administration of sEVs derived from cerebral endothelial cells (CEC-sEVs), we showed that the CEC-sEVs were preferentially taken up by the activated neurons, leading to significant improvement of functional outcome after stroke, which was associated with augmentation of peri-infarct cortical axonal/dendritic outgrowth and of axonal remodelling of the corticospinal tract. The ultrastructural and Western blot analyses revealed that neurons with internalization of CEC-sEVs exhibited significantly reduced numbers of damaged mitochondria and proteins that mediate dysfunctional mitochondria, respectively. Together, these data indicate that the augmented uptake of CEC-sEVs by activated peri-infarct cortical interneurons facilitates neuronal circuitry remodelling and functional recovery after stroke, which has the potential to be a novel therapy for improving stroke recovery.

摘要

由兴奋性和抑制性神经元组成的神经回路重塑对于改善中风后的神经学预后至关重要。临床前研究表明,小细胞外囊泡(sEVs)对中风恢复具有治疗作用。然而,使用sEVs特异性靶向单个神经元群体以增强中风后神经回路重塑极具挑战性。在本研究中,我们采用化学遗传学方法特异性激活梗死周围皮质中间神经元,并联合给予源自脑内皮细胞的sEVs(CEC-sEVs),结果表明激活的神经元优先摄取CEC-sEVs,从而显著改善中风后的功能预后,这与梗死周围皮质轴突/树突生长增加以及皮质脊髓束的轴突重塑有关。超微结构和蛋白质印迹分析显示,内化CEC-sEVs的神经元中受损线粒体数量以及介导线粒体功能障碍的蛋白质数量分别显著减少。总之,这些数据表明,激活的梗死周围皮质中间神经元对CEC-sEVs摄取增加有助于中风后神经回路重塑和功能恢复,这有可能成为改善中风恢复的一种新疗法。
